Bottle at Craig’s. It pours hazy rose pink with a medium white head. The nose is soft, sweet, ripe blueberry, fruit cake, blueberry muffin and candy. The taste is crisp, bitter – sweet, blueberry muffin, icing sugar, cake, bit of soapy citrus peel and maple syrup. Medium body and moderate carbonation. I was worried that this was going to be a bit too sweet, but the balance works out. Decent stuff.

Bottle. Archer Road Beer Stop, Sheffield. Hazy, dark pink. Film, and some bubbles of clingy, off white head. Big on the blueberry. Grapefruit hop. Some sweetness, although I’d not have said maple syrup. Mind you, once it warms, maybe so? Taste is fruity tart. Some sweetness. Clean mouthfeel. Finishes fruity, tart, soft bitter, with a light dry close.
